Communication problems at Ferrari
After radio trouble: Hamilton gets a new race engineer

His debut season at Ferrari was disappointing for Lewis Hamilton. Will everything be different this year? His employer has now announced an important personnel decision.
Seven-time Formula 1 world champion Lewis Hamilton is getting a new racing engineer at Ferrari. Riccardo Adami is transferred after several arguments with the 41-year-old Briton that were heard over the team radio.
Ferrari announced that the 52-year-old Italian will, among other things, be responsible for the traditional racing team’s youth work in the future. A successor to Adami, who also worked with Sebastian Vettel at Ferrari, will be announced “in due course”.
For Hamilton, the first season in the red racing car was historically bad. For the first time in his entire Grand Prix career, he remained without a podium finish. Communication with Adami on the pit radio repeatedly led to frustration and incomprehension for the experienced driver during the races. Ferrari will present its new racing car for the coming season on January 23rd.
